description
NICE's work spans three interlinked ecosystems: life sciences, guidelines and information. The three join together through the provision of advice on best practice to help ensure the adoption of cost- effective innovation. The life sciences ecosystem spans product development through regulation to launch and adoption, with NICE playing a key role in the evaluation of clinical and cost effectiveness. The guidelines ecosystem involves developing best practice recommendations, advice and quality standards, mainly for frontline practitioners and extending across the whole care system.
The Executive Team has recently undergone significant levels of change with introduction of new roles. Our new Chief Executive joined NICE on 1st February 2022. In addition, we have recruited to several additional executive roles which will support the delivery of our strategy. Appointments to these roles should be completed by January 2023.
In order to develop a common approach to transformation within our newly formed executive team, we need to respect and honour the best elements of our leadership teams past experiences and integrate them with the new approaches recently appointed directors will bring so we are creating a shared future leadership and transformational style.
We require a leadership development programme that will:
| • | Support the implementation and embedding of our target culture through role modelling appropriate behaviours |
| • | Reduce silo working and encourage collaborative working, encourage a 'one team with a shared purpose' approach to transformational change |
| • | Creates a collective leadership style taking the best of the past and present and forming a leadership style that is right for us and will enable us to transform in the way we need to |
| • | Develop a leadership mindset with a desire to understand, respond and develop a partnership approach to tackling complex issues and reward empowerment. |
| • | Enable us to become more action focused by accepting more risk (as appropriate), trusting in the direction and focusing more on the change requirements |
| • | An evaluation process that provides evidence of any tangible and sustainable changes to our culture and leadership practices |
| • | Ensure that all members of the executive team have participated in the development programme within the timeframes set out above. |
